H04 C41500 Brass vs. H04 C65100 Bronze

Both H04 C41500 brass and H04 C65100 bronze are copper alloys. Both are furnished in the H04 (full hard) temper. They have a moderately high 92%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is H04 C41500 brass and the bottom bar is H04 C65100 bronze.
